  • Page 10: Wan: Keep Online

    On this screen you can configure a PING to check the MTX-StarEnergy’s connectivity. If the PING fails X times (a configurable value) consecutively, the 4G/3G/2G session will be restarted. See the additional notes on this point for more options. contact@webdyn.com | webdyn.com V 5.2.4.10.7.14 subject to change | Webdyn © by Flexitron...

  • Page 22: Other: Time Servers (Ntp)

    The MTX-StarEnergy router has a supercap real-time clock that enables it to keep time even if power is lost. Said internal clock periodically needs to be synchronized with time servers using the NTP protocol, meaning the device always has the correct time. contact@webdyn.com | webdyn.com V 5.2.4.10.7.14 subject to change | Webdyn © by Flexitron...
